Crock Pot Chicken with Apple Pecan Stuffing

Ingredients
- 4 to 6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 3 tablespoons butter
- 1/2 cup chopped onion
- 1/2 cup chopped celery
- 1 cup chopped apple (about 1 apple)
- 1/3 cup applesauce
- 1/4 cup chopped pecans
- 1 box Stove Top stuffing mix (6 oz)
- 1/2 cup water
- 1 can cream of chicken soup (Healthy Request or low fat)
Details
Servings 4
Adapted from recipegreat.com
Preparation
Step 1
Wash chicken breasts and pat dry; place in Crock Pot. Melt the butter in a skillet over medium low heat and saute the chopped onion, celery, and apple. Add pecans, water, applesauce, cream of chicken soup, and stuffing mix. Mix together; spoon over chicken in the Crock Pot. Cover and cook on low for 6 to 8 hours.
